Abstract

An example apparatus includes a sensing area including a sensor matrix, a first conductor and a second conductor. The first conductor is coupled to a first sensor of the sensor matrix and is configured to be coupled to a sensing module. The second conductor is coupled to a second sensor of the sensor matrix and is configured to be coupled to the sensing module. In embodiments, the first sensor consumes a first area, the second sensor and a length of the first conductor reside within a second area that is smaller than or equal to the first area consumed by the first sensor, and the length of the first conductor is routed between an edge of the sensing area and the second sensor.
